INNOVATE Corp. (VATE)
NYSE: VATE · Real-Time Price · USD
5.34
-0.08 (-1.48%)
Feb 11, 2026, 4:00 PM EST - Market closed

INNOVATE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
736697147288250
Market Cap Growth
-50.60%-32.78%-33.49%-49.08%15.25%150.47%
Enterprise Value
7628008879901,076796
Last Close Price
5.424.9412.3018.7037.0032.60
PS Ratio
0.060.060.070.090.240.35
PB Ratio
--0.46-0.71-4.9524.180.41
P/TBV Ratio
-----0.90
P/FCF Ratio
1.24-12.03-99.2210.72
P/OCF Ratio
0.857.203.68-10.666.08
EV/Sales Ratio
0.690.720.620.610.891.11
EV/EBITDA Ratio
15.9510.9714.0615.7733.8466.36
EV/EBIT Ratio
45.1220.0032.7548.07--
EV/FCF Ratio
12.77-109.56-371.1234.17
Debt / Equity Ratio
-3.48-5.00-5.66-26.5358.850.98
Debt / EBITDA Ratio
7.545.986.216.499.6323.24
Debt / FCF Ratio
12.12-95.30-241.4825.94
Asset Turnover
1.221.141.301.470.310.11
Inventory Turnover
46.6941.5958.4578.8875.9557.14
Quick Ratio
0.400.721.161.210.940.05
Current Ratio
0.430.811.251.291.011.05
Return on Equity (ROE)
-----27.49%-9.93%
Return on Assets (ROA)
1.17%2.58%1.54%1.15%-0.09%-0.14%
Return on Invested Capital (ROIC)
3.57%7.40%4.41%3.07%-0.63%-1.33%
Return on Capital Employed (ROCE)
-27.70%9.80%4.30%2.80%-0.90%-1.90%
Earnings Yield
-101.23%-52.81%-36.12%-24.50%-79.06%-36.85%
FCF Yield
80.37%-16.94%8.31%-20.61%1.01%9.33%
Buyback Yield / Dilution
-39.55%-36.88%-0.83%-0.52%-53.28%-12.28%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q